Tropical Sugar Cookies

PREP TIME
20 min
COOKING TIME
10 min
TOTAL TIME
30 min
SERVINGS
16 servings

Ingredients
- 1 1/4 cups white sugar
- 1/2 cup butter, softened
- 1/2 cup coconut oil
- 3 egg yolks
- 1 1/2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 2 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
Instructions
1
Preheat your oven to a high temperature of 350 degrees Fahrenheit (or 175 degrees Celsius for metric measurements).
2
Next, prepare your baking sheet by lightly coating it with a thin layer of oil or lining it with parchment paper to prevent sticking.
3
In a large mixing bowl, combine sugar, butter, and coconut oil using an electric mixer to blend them into a smooth and airy mixture.
4
Add egg yolks one at a time, followed by the addition of vanilla extract to enhance flavor.
5
Gradually incorporate flour, baking powder, and baking soda into the mixture, stirring until the dough just forms a cohesive mass.
6
Using your hands, thoroughly mix and blend the ingredients to ensure they are fully incorporated.
7
Shape the dough into small walnut-sized balls, leaving about 2 inches of space between each ball on the prepared baking sheet.
8
Bake the cookies in the preheated oven until their tops are cracked and dry, taking around 10 to 12 minutes.
